Article Critical Care Medicine

Kinetic Changes of Plasma Renin Concentrations Predict Acute Kidney Injury in Cardiac Surgery Patients

Mira Kuellmar et al.

Summary: Elevated renin concentrations are associated with cardiovascular instability and increased AKI after cardiac surgery. Elevated renin concentrations could be used to identify high-risk patients for cardiovascular instability and AKI who would benefit from timely intervention that could improve their outcomes.

Article Medicine, Research & Experimental

Biomarkers of inflammation and repair in kidney disease progression

Jeremy Puthumana et al.

Summary: The study found that levels of MCP-1 and YKL-40 measured at 3 months after hospitalization were associated with long-term risk of kidney failure, while UMOD levels were linked with decreased risk of kidney injury. Using a multimarker score provided better accuracy in predicting patients' risk of kidney disease progression compared to traditional clinical variables.
